What to Expect: The Personal Injury Claim Process
Working with legal counsel typically follows a structured trajectory. Comprehending these phases helps demystify the legal journey.
- Initial Consultation and Case Evaluation: The lawyer examines the realities of the case, examines liability, and figures out if there are premises for a claim.
- Examination and Evidence Gathering: The legal group gathers authorities reports, medical records, security footage, and eyewitness testaments.
- Medical Treatment and Stabilization: Attorneys typically encourage customers to finish their medical treatments so the complete scope of damages can be recorded.
- Need Letter and Negotiation: A thorough need plan is sent out to the opposing insurance provider, initiating negotiations for a reasonable settlement.
- Litigation (If Necessary): If the insurer refuses to provide a sensible settlement, the attorney submits an official suit and prepares the case for trial.

2. Just how much does accident legal counsel cost?
The majority of injury attorneys run on a contingency cost arrangement. Instead of paying hourly rates, the attorney gets an agreed-upon percentage (generally between 33% and 40%) of the final settlement or court award. If they do not win your case, you owe them absolutely nothing for their legal services.
3. What if I was partly at fault for the accident?
Depending upon the jurisdiction, you may still be entitled to compensation under comparative negligence laws. Even if you bear some obligation, an experienced lawyer can assist decrease your designated percentage of fault to optimize your monetary recovery.
4. Will my case certainly go to trial?
No. The huge majority of personal Injury Compensation Lawyer cases-- frequently upwards of 90%-- are settled out of court through negotiations. Nevertheless, having a lawyer who is completely prepared to go to trial offers important leverage during these negotiations.
